svn commit: r219917 - projects/sv/sys/netinet
Attilio Rao
attilio at FreeBSD.org
Wed Mar 23 16:17:25 UTC 2011
Author: attilio
Date: Wed Mar 23 16:17:24 2011
New Revision: 219917
URL: http://svn.freebsd.org/changeset/base/219917
Log:
Once the device is looked up, check if it supports netdump.
Submitted by: rstone
Modified:
projects/sv/sys/netinet/netdump_client.c
Modified: projects/sv/sys/netinet/netdump_client.c
==============================================================================
--- projects/sv/sys/netinet/netdump_client.c Wed Mar 23 16:02:07 2011 (r219916)
+++ projects/sv/sys/netinet/netdump_client.c Wed Mar 23 16:17:24 2011 (r219917)
@@ -1096,7 +1096,8 @@ netdump_trigger(void *arg, int howto)
IFNET_RLOCK_NOSLEEP();
TAILQ_FOREACH(nd_ifp, &V_ifnet, if_link) {
if (!strncmp(nd_ifp->if_xname, nd_ifp_str,
- strlen(nd_ifp->if_xname))) {
+ strlen(nd_ifp->if_xname)) &&
+ netdump_supported_nic(nd_ifp)) {
found = 1;
break;
}
More information about the svn-src-projects
mailing list